Two-vehicle collision causes moderate damage on I-85, Salisbury NC
A collision between two vehicles occurred in the median of I-85 near Salisbury. The accident caused moderate damage and there were possible injuries. Initially, both drivers were reported trapped but were later found to be free. Fire and EMS units responded, blocked lanes for safety, and requested additional support to shield the scene. There was no evidence of criminal activity or driving under the influence.
